I do not know if this is a bug or another kind of problem... but here is what happens:

Have been using FTP upload (every 10 minutes) for years and it works fine (no "multiple identical images").

A week ago we had several days with beautiful sunsets/evenings and I wanted to take a shot at making a TimeLapse 8)
...so I entered settings - file and an image to be saved to local disk every 30 seconds with "I want to include the date and time in the file name". What happened was that Yawcam stores ONE image every 30 second as it should but as many as 5 images after one another turns out to be exactly the same image. This happens time after time during the day I enabled file save. First I was not 100 % sure the images were identical... but then came the ferry... and it does not remain exactly (and I mean exactly) at the same spot unless it is by the dock - and it was not. This was 5 images with half a minute in between showing the ferry in exactly the same spot on its way to port for unloading cars. Checking more images thoroughly I can see that Yawcam stores identical images MANY times a day instead of only storing new updated images.

Yawcam Version 0.4.1 built: 2013-04-18
What might be wrong and what can I hopefully do with that? :?

I think the webcam might be disconnected between every picture and it doesn't have time to reconnect the camera before it takes it's picture. You can try to keep the camera connected by enabling the stream option.

If the stream keeps the camera connected, when it takes the picture every 30 seconds, the picture should be good.

I use Yawcam to take snapshots at 2 second intervals 24/7 (approx. 30,000 images/1.2 GB per day) and have had many issues with Yawcam and the latest Java 7 updates. I wouldn't be surprised if the OP is not similarly effected.

Once I reverted to jre-7u13 both Yawcam_0.3.8 and Yawcam_0.4.1 work well 24/7 with the exception that changing the default PS3Eye 75 fps to say 10 fps isn't retained between sessions/reboots (but that may be a camera issue rather than Yawcam limitation).

As neither computer is used for web browsing, running an outdated java version isn't an issue if brings reliability. To disable the java auto-update under Windows 7 I needed to run the java control panel applet

C:\Program Files\Java\jre7\bin\javacpl.exe

using "Run as administrator".

I don't use video streaming, etc. and haven't tested jre-7u45 so YMMV.

Code: Select all

jre-7u25 u40 Yawcam 0.4.1 symptoms
-----------------------------------

closes after 3-7 days of running
saved picture might freeze and not update with the preview window
saved picture might be black and preview normal
preview picture might be black
Yawam often closes unexpectedly when changing PS3Eye Properties/Format
PS3Eye Format isn't retained between Yawcam sessions or a after a reboot (Device properties are).

Images older than 60 days are purged weekly using task scheduler and "Cyber-D's Autodelete".
Days of interest are converted to 20 minute .avi's for review using "ImagesToVideo" v3.
Yawcam 0.3.8 saves empty 0Kb image files with jre-7u25 and u40 so isn't usable.
